Output 59e8e677600aa71e0f6c5bcb2521bbd6aab3b664df20512e07472e88a6334741:0

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3751c037e0a8d9b4ae0b3422b2f49b27f4759 OP_EQUAL
address
3BMEXQYVnWYVxtkVbDHxavGaouD2qzXqAj
transaction
59e8e677600aa71e0f6c5bcb2521bbd6aab3b664df20512e07472e88a6334741
spent
true